2005 TL Navi in KC
by stickyman on Sun Sep 11 07:46:54 PDT 2005
I purchased a 05 TL w/Navi this past Friday at Superior Acura in Overland Park, Ks. I received a "Good" deal from my point of view :P . Probably not the greatest in history but, I'm a happy camper. From the time I sent the first email to the internet manager, I was signing the papers and left in 3.5 hours :D . I purchased a Met. Silver for $32,650.00 plus $195.00 Doc. fee. For $989.00 more, I purchased (or pre-paid) for the next 45,000 miles maintence (includes filters, oil chgs, tire rotation- -everything that is listed in book). I traded in a 2003 TL TypeS with 47,800 miles. I received $18,800.00 for my trade. I pick up the new TL tomorrow. Very good dealership and I highly recommend them to anyone in the mid-west. $31,116 for 2005 TL w/AT-WOW, what an experience & nice car!
by c6corvette on Tue Dec 28 00:48:45 PST 2004
Today we went to buy a 2005 TL w/AT. We drove both the TSX and the TL. She liked them both, and so did I. But the 2005 TL w/5spd AT is a real treat! But, I AM SO tight, I SQUEEK.....   Having just had my Red 2002 Firehawk totaled, by a Camry no less, I voted 2005 TL w/270 hp.   We agreed on a price, while she was looking at all the different colors and driving several cars. She wanted white/parchment. But they did not want to honor the price on that color. I guess there is a limit on the number of white cars, which is the most favorite color in the Kansas City area.   So, I walked away from the deal at $31,500 including doc fee, lug nut locks, and the rear spoiler. THIS would have been a great deal!   EVEN THOUGH WE NAILED DOWN THE PRICE BEFORE selecting the color, the manager was balking. So, I started to leave and said we would check with his competition. While getting ready to leave, my wife said, "Go back in, I want the Silver/Ebony 2005 TL w/AT". (she changed her mind for the 6th time!) Since this is really about me letting her pick a car she wants, I said OK.   I went it to talk to the manager. He explained the salesman made a mistake and quoted me $334 for the rear spoiler, when it really was the “cost” on a front spoiler. He said, “This is a great deal for you”. But, I don’t like taking advantage of an honest mistake. I would expect the same, if I made a math mistake!   I replied, "I don't want to get anyone in trouble, since we are getting a good price! Take the spoiler off: $31,500 - $335 = $31,165 (which includes locks at $50.50 and shipping at $570).   So, $31,165 less invoice ($29,982.29 + $570 shipping + $50.50 for locks = $30,602.79 Add the $169 doc fee which = $30,771.79). I HATE doc fees!!! I have never paid them before, but my dear wanted the car and I said, "OK!"   So I hate to admit it! I did not get into holdback, and I paid $562.21 OVER INVOICE! (w/$169 doc fee). They tell me this is a great deal for the KC area.
